A rabbit should have time to notice you. If you suddenly appear in its vision, this can startle it. If frightened too badly, it may jerk to the side and injure itself. Aside my main responsibility of change management, senior management, business relations and human aspects, I was a core member of ... NettetThe best approach is to take things slowly. Never push a bunny to do anything they obviously don’t enjoy, and avoid imposing cuddles and interaction until you have built up your rabbits’ trust. Bunnies like to sniff around and investigate, just like cats and dogs, but they need more time. It’s also important to interact with your rabbits ...

Nettet17. feb. 2024 · Hold them along your arm, with their head in the crook of your elbow. Tuck them into your arm, with their head under your elbow. Cup a small rabbit in both hands. Carry them in a towel. Hold them upright, with paws and pump both supported by your arms.
